Bedias, Bhatus and Kanjars

Bedia, Bhatu and Kanjar castes reside in Shamsabad, Fatehabad, Pinahat, Barauli Ahir, Fatehpur Sikri and Achhnera development blocks of Agra district. Women from these castes are engaged in sex for money, while men folk are engaged in criminal activities like theft, robbery, kidnapping and illicit sale of liquor. As the social environment in rural areas is considerably different from the one in urban areas, families of these caste groups live a little away from the main village and carry out their activities from there.

Charitable Clinic

JCSS is running a charitable Ayurvedic clinic at Shaheed Nagar, Agra. Using Ayurvedic, Panchkarma and Indian traditional health systems, people are provided treatment to their ailments. JCSS sees the role of traditional healers as complimentary to modern medicine.
